Paranormal Activity 5: The Ghost Dimension Rumored To Be In 3-D

Shawn Loeffler by  Shawn Loeffler  on @YellMagazine11/28/2014
Facebook
TwitterTweet

Paranormal Activity 5: The Ghost Dimension in 3D

I’m not sure how interesting 3-D will be for the Paranormal franchise considering the franchise’s history of a low-fi presentation. About all I can see happening is a bunch of stuff being thrown at the screen to cause the audience to jump, and that’s going to get tired after about five minutes. Nonetheless, Bloody Disgusting is reporting that Paramount Pictures’ Paranormal Activity 5: The Ghost Dimension will get the 3-D treatment in post.

Not only that, but the studio has put the film on the fast track and filming has begun in order to get it to the screen on its originally intended March 13, 2015, release date.

BD is also speculating that the upcoming Friday the 13th release could also be in 3-D since Paramount is playing with the tech for Paranormal Activity 5. Now, 3-D for Friday the 13th makes sense! Because it’s been done before and is part of the franchise’s legacy.
